May 26, 2020 · Chapter 7 vs. Chapter 11 Like Chapter 7, Chapter 11 requires that a trustee be appointed. However, rather than selling off all assets to pay back creditors, the trustee supervises the assets of ... Posted by Brian Stocker MA.Feb 14, 2012 · 1.1.1 Medical Surge Capacity; 1.1.2 Medical Surge Capability; 1.1.3 Requirements of MSCC Strategies; The concept of medical surge forms the cornerstone of preparedness planning efforts for major medical incidents. It is important, therefore, to define this term before analyzing solutions for the overall needs of mass casualty or mass effect ...

Immediate and Short-term Trauma Reactions 1Short-term trauma occurs during or immediately after the crime and lasts for about 3 months (Kilpatrick, 2000). This time frame for short-term versus long-term trauma is based on several studies showing that most crime victims achieve considerable recovery sometime between 1 and 3 months after the crime. Most medical terms are comprised of a root word plus a suffix (word ending) and/or a prefix (beginning of the word). Here are some examples related to the Integumentary System. For more details see Chapter 4: Understanding the Components of Medical Terminology
